Worried about workplace violence and the damage that it could cost them, most small business organizations are mandating drug screening as part of the pre employment investigations for all new positions. Drug screening kits are widely available and have the advantage of being much cheaper for the organization. The potential candidate is also spared from having to go to a laboratory for drug testing.
Most pre manufactured drug screening kits test for a five drugs including consisting of marijuana (THC), cocaine, PCP, opiates (such as codeine and morphine) and amphetamines (including methamphetamine). Some employers use a 10-panel test, which tests for prescription drugs as well as alcohol.
The most common type of a drug screening kits available involves collecting urine samples in small, disposable screening cups. These cups give quick results for up to ten different drugs, so the chances are that a candidate who is a high drug user or who has been taking drugs for a long time will not be able to pass the test. The drug screening kits also have markings on them that will help an employer detect if the candidate is a recreational drug user or a heavy drug user.
While requiring candidates to undergo drug testing as part of the employee screening process, employers need to get written permission from the candidates. In addition, employers need to be aware of the law regarding use of drug information for that particular state.
